What will you be doing?
- Health Surveillance: Conduct essential health assessments such as audiometry, spirometry, and vision screening, ensuring employee health risks are monitored and managed.
- Clinical Assessments & Documentation: Undertake pre-placement health assessments, document outcomes, and communicate findings to stakeholders.
- Data Management & Reporting: Record health surveillance data with precision, providing insights that support trend analysis and proactive risk management.
- Employee Support & Engagement: Support employees by providing information on health resources, mental health support, and wellness initiatives.
- Policy Adherence: Ensure compliance with KP’s EHW policies and practices, working closely with HR and health and safety teams to uphold a consistent approach.
- Collaboration & Communication: Partner with EHW Advisors, site HR, and health and safety professionals, contributing to KP’s culture of wellbeing and continuous improvement.
